SSIS Script Task for Advanced Logging Techniques
By Tom Nonmacher
In the world of data management, logging in SQL Server Integration Services (SSIS) is a fundamental process that should not be overlooked. It offers a deep insight into the execution of packages, helping you understand the performance and troubleshoot issues. With SQL Server 2022, Azure SQL, and other contemporary technologies, the SSIS Script Task has become even more powerful in extending logging capabilities. This post will explore some advanced logging techniques using SSIS Script Task on these platforms for better tracking and error handling.
Before diving into the advanced techniques, it's worth looking at the basic setup of the Script Task for logging. It requires the use of a language like VB or C#, where you can write custom code for more complex operations. The essentials include defining the log entry information and calling the Log method of the Dts object.
public void Main()
{
// Setting up log entry details
string logDescription = "My Log Entry";
string logName = "MyLog";
int logInformation = 0;
byte[] logData = null;
// Calling the Log method
Dts.Log(logDescription, logInformation, logData);
Dts.TaskResult = (int)ScriptResults.Success;
}
